    Nordsjaelland’s Prince Amoako Jr eyes ‘dream’ Black Stars call-up

    Kenneth Nii Tete AnnanBy Kenneth Nii Tete AnnanJanuary 15, 2026No Comments2 Mins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Copy Link

    FC Nordsjaelland forward Prince Amoako Jr says he has his sights set on a call-up to the Black Stars.  Amoako Jr has been a great addition to the Danish side since the start of the season as Nordsjaelland chase a playoff spot.

    Having seen teammate Caleb Yirenkyi play for the national team in recent times, Amoako Jr is also looking to get into such an environment.  “We’ve had conversations about the national team, but it’s never been about what’s on the inside,” he told Joy Sports.

    “On the outside, from what I see, the national team is always good to play. You’re representing your country and representing the very place that made you.”

    He also believes being invited to the national team will be a morale booster for his performance and confidence.  “For me, it’s always a big deal to play in the national team and to be called up for it. It would mean the world to be, and it would just elevate my confidence, and everything else will just align,” he added.

    “But right now, to play in the national team is a very big dream for me.”

    Amoako Jr has been involved in 11 goals in 21 appearances across all competitions for Nordsjaelland, scoring six and assisting five.
